At the campus of the university at the 'Pfaffenwaldring' in Stuttgart-Vahingen, Germany, Baden-Württemberg is an old windmill on a public display. It is called Windkraftanlage 'Ulrich Hütter'.

The windmill was constructured by Ulrich Hütter the former leader of the 'Institute für Flugzeugbau' of the university. This is the mother of all modern windmills. The year of construction is 1949. It is here on display since May 2003.

This type of windmill has been produced in a huge number in the 1950s to produce electrical energy.

Its height is 9.90m.
The diameter of the rotor is 11.28m.
This produces a power of 6 kW.
